Abstract
The purpose of this study is to investigate the e-servicescape of Indonesian website based on customer perception in Surabaya - Indonesia. E-servicescape concept comprises three main components; firstly is website aesthetic appeal which evaluate design originality, visual appeal, and entertainment aspect; secondly is website layout and functionality which evaluate features functionality, information relevancy, customization features, and interaction features; finally website financial security which evaluate perceived security and payment easiness. There were 200 respondents who frequently purchase product via online are collected through purposive sampling technique. Structural equation modelling was used to analyze the research data. The findings revealed descriptive charateristic of online shopping behavior as well as the customer evaluation on web e-servicescape.
